SQL语句中带单引号
时间: 2023-10-28 15:06:01 浏览: 170
sql语句中单引号嵌套问题(一定要避免直接嵌套)
回答: 在SQL语句中,如果需要在查询条件中使用单引号,最好使用参数化查询来避免SQL注入的风险。如果必须使用单引号,可以通过在单引号前再加一个单引号来转义。例如,如果要查询Name为abc'cc的记录,可以使用以下语句:SELECT * FROM [TABLE] WHERE [Name] = 'abc''cc'。[1]另外,单引号在SQL语句中还可以用来表示字符串的开始和结束,例如在Insert语句中插入一个带单引号的字符串,可以使用两个单引号来表示一个单引号。例如,可以使用以下代码来插入一个带单引号的字符串:string content = txtContent.Text.Trim(); content = content.Replace("'", "''"); string sql = "insert into t_test (colA) values ('" + content + "')";[2][3]
阅读全文